In early 2025, the Barr Foundation Board of Trustees announced that Jim Canales will conclude his tenure as President by the end of 2025, when he will continue as a trustee and step into a new leadership role as Chair of the Board.
Barr’s board has retained the global executive search firm Russell Reynolds Associates to partner with the Foundation on a national search for a new President. The board has constituted a Presidential Search Committee, chaired by Barbara Hostetter.
On March 21, 2025, the Search Committee released the position specification.
On August 13, 2025, the Board of Trustees announced that Ali Noorani will be the new president of the Barr Foundation. To learn more about Ali Noorani, please read our release in News + Insights.
To provide Barr’s next president with maximum flexibility, Barr has decided to defer the recruitment of a new Vice President for Strategy and Programs (to succeed Roger Nozaki, who stepped down from the position in May 2025, as we announced last Fall).
Mariella Puerto, Director of Barr’s Climate program, has assumed additional responsibilities as Interim Vice President for Strategy and Programs. We are grateful to Mariella for her willingness to step in to this important leadership role.
